Tutorial 6: Digital Object Identifiers for your Github Data


Overview

There are a few tools and platforms that offer DOI creation for files, datasets, or software associated with GitHub. However, Zenodo is the most widely known and trusted service for assigning DOIs to GitHub-hosted content. Thus, this tutorial will focus on using this tool.

Introduction

A DOI (Digital Object Identifier) provides a persistent, globally unique, and citable reference to a specific version of your dataset or software. Under the FAIR data principles—Findable, Accessible, Interoperable, and Reusable—DOIs play a critical role in ensuring that:

🔎 Findable: Data can be reliably located through metadata indexing services like DataCite or CrossRef.

🔗 Accessible: A DOI ensures there’s a stable link to a publicly available version (or metadata record).

📚 Reusable: Citation via DOI promotes proper attribution, credit, and encourages ethical data reuse.

🧬 Versioned and Documented: DOIs can be assigned to specific releases of data/software, creating an auditable research trail.

In short, DOIs support transparency, reproducibility, and proper data citation, making them a key element of FAIR-aligned research.

Zenodo.org is a free, reputable platform maintained by CERN and OpenAIRE. It integrates with GitHub to automatically archive releases and assign a DOI.

✅ Step-by-Step Instructions

  1. Prepare Your GitHub Repository Make sure your repository has:
  • A clear README.md (describing the project or data).
  • A LICENSE file (open licenses like MIT, CC-BY, etc. are recommended). See Github
  • A versioned release (Zenodo will archive specific releases, not your live repo). See Github
  1. Create a Zenodo Account
  • Go to https://zenodo.org
  • Click Sign In (you can use your GitHub, ORCID, or other credentials).

Once signed in, go to your Dashboard.

  1. Connect Your GitHub Account to Zenodo
  • Go to Zenodo GitHub Settings
  • Click Connect GitHub.
  • Authorize Zenodo to access your GitHub account.

You’ll see a list of your repositories—flip the toggle to enable archiving for the repo you want to assign a DOI.

  1. Create a GitHub Release DOIs are generated only for releases, not for every commit.
  • In your GitHub repository, click the "Releases" tab.
  • Click “Draft a new release”.
  • Tag it with a version number (e.g., v1.0.0).
  • Add a title and description (e.g., “Initial release of dataset”).
  • Click Publish release.

Zenodo will automatically archive this release and assign a unique DOI.

  1. Find Your DOI on Zenodo
  • Go back to Zenodo.org
  • Click Dashboard → Uploads or GitHub
  • Click on your project

You’ll see a permanent DOI like this:

10.5281/zenodo.1234567

This DOI is now persistent, citable, and indexed.
